Denver, officially the City and County of Denver, is the capital of the state of Colorado. It is the most populous city in the state. The city is located in the South Platte River Valley on the western edge of the High Plains, just east of the Rocky Mountains. There are nearly 100 breweries in metro Denver, and city annually hosts the Great American Beer Festival. The city offers outdoor adventures such as skiing, swimming, hiking, white water rafting, as well as culture, art, fashion, dining, music, and shopping.

Real Estate in Denver According to US News the average cost to buy a home in Denver is approximately $362,000, which is significantly higher than the national average. There are many affordable options for those who are looking to rent instead of buying a home in Denver. The monthly cost to rent is slightly above the national average. The cost of buying a home in Denver varies greatly depending on the neighborhood. To buy a home in Hilltop, Belcaro, or Cherry Creek, cost 4-5 times as much as a home in Windsor, Highline Villages, or Dayton Triangle. It is cheaper to rent it those neighborhoods as well. The cost of living in Denver is slightly above the national average.

Living in Denver, CO Denver, The Mile High City, is where urban sophistication meets outdoor adventure. Denver is an outdoor city known for its world-class cultural attractions, thriving craft breweries, chef-driven dining and red-hot music scene, all within easy reach of the Rocky Mountains. The city offers more than 5,000 acres of parks, trails, golf courses, and playgrounds.

Downtown Denver, is the city's hip, historic district, with a huge independent bookstore, brewpubs, Western wear, Coors Field, and dozens of dining and nightlife options. Five Points neighborhood is filled with coffeehouses, museums, taprooms, festivals, and mouthwatering soul food and barbecue. Uptown Denver has Restaurant Row, Denver Zoo, Denver Museum of Nature and Science, Avenue Theater, and spacious City Park. Art District on Santa Fe, has more than 30 art galleries, studios, and innovative business. Cheery Creek North is the premier outdoor retail and dining destination with an impressive collection of art galleries, independently owned boutiques, internal fashion brands, and luxury hotel options. South Broadway is known for its amazing antique stores, avant-garde clothing stores, used bookstores, ethnic restaurants, and live music venues. River North Art District is full of urban charm and industrial renewal with jazz bars, eateries, brewpubs, art galleries, studios, and creative events.

Transportation and commutes in Denver Almost all working Denver residents commute by driving alone, or commute via carpool. The Regional Transportation District (RTD) operates buses, light rail, and commuter rail around the Denver metropolitan area. Greyhound Lines, Inc provides inter-city bus service from Denver to New York City, Portland, Reno, Las Vegas, and Dallas. Amtrak provides daily rail service to and from Denver as a stop on the California Zephyr's route between Chicago and Emeryville.

Denver International Airport (DEN) is the main and largest airport in the Denver area. It is one of the busiest and most trafficked airports in the world. The airport provides flights to domestic destinations all over the country, some destinations have seasonal flights. It also provides flights to international destinations, primarily in Mexico, Canada, and Europe.
